Learning at the Liberry

My job at the liberry are going pretty good. I'm learning stuff real fast. Like yesterday a woman come in and asked me where she could find a book wrote by somebody name of Evelyn Waugh. I told her her books was listed under the "W's" on the far back shelf. The woman laughed and said Evelyn warn't no woman; she, I mean he, were a man. I thought about that a lot since, about how hard it would be to go around with a woman's name if you was a man. I mean if my folks had named me Mildred or Grace, I don't know what would have become of me. And about a hour later a man come in and asked me if we had a book called A Separate Piece. I figured he were looking for a ponygraphical book and I told him we didn't carry no books like that. Myrtle Picket, the head liberry person, come up and taken over. She went right to the shelves and come back with the book. She showed me it warn't A Separate Piece a'tall   but was named A Separate Peace. Like I says I'm learning a lot down at the liberry.
